[geomesa-users] Is there available an asynchronous or lazy Java CQL driver for on-demand return of large resultsets from Accumulo?

Hi all,


We are returning large resultsets from Accumulo (1.7.2) while running Geomesa 1.2.1. Our system frequently runs slow and locks up. We believe our problems owe to our use, in our queries, of the non-lazy FeatureIterator. The problem seems to be that our query returns our entire resultset, loads that set into the FeatureIterator, before we traverse that FeatureIterator, converting features into protobuf and returning to the client.


Our NATS server does not appear to be the bottleneck. We have noticed via metrics that the query itself takes the substantial portion of time.


Do we have available an asynchronous or lazy Geomesa driver or iterator enabling return of large results sets as they are returned from Accumulo? Is such asynchronous/lazy functionality available in Geomesa 1.2.1 or any newer version of Geomesa?
